If either of you is in receipt of a state pension then you can obtain free healthcare for both of you. Just go to the Ayuntamiento with your proof of pension and talk to Social Services and they will sort you out. If only one of you has a pension then the other is listed as your dependent and also qualifies.

Most EU nationals living in Britain are working and paying taxes. They are not receiving reciprocal healthcare.
Brits in Spain (of UK pensionable age) currently receive free reciprocal healthcare. It is free reciprocal healthcare that is at risk due to Brexit.
